About this condo rental

Situated in LoDo, this lovely condo for $117 per night is a great choice for your next trip. If the Millennium Bridge is the gateway to Riverfront then the Promenade Lofts are the residences guarding the gate. Reflective of their name, the lofts are located at the end of the passage-way into Commons Park. This condo is ideal for business travelers and others looking for longer stays in the downtown corridor. Whether you want to stay in the abundant local Riverfront neighborhood or explore LoDo or LoHi, the trail is awaiting outside the lobby. This residence is ideally located and a short walk to the most sought after amenities in the city. Coors Field, the Pepsi Center, Mile High Stadium, the 16th Street Mall, Commons Park, Confluence Park, Cherry Creek Trail and the Platte River Trail are all in the immediate proximity of this luxury three-bedroom condo. In the heart of Denver’s finest dining and shopping districts. Numerous restaurants and bars fill the plaza adjacent to the building, and Lo-Do, the Highlands, and Larimer are all just a short walk away. The Promenade Lofts, where this residence is located, is just across the Millennium Bridge from the end of the 16th Street Mall and adjacent to the central light rail terminal at Union Station. You won’t need a car while you’re here, as everything downtown Denver has to offer is within walking distance to this residence. Underground parking available with one assigned space. This 1800 sq ft loft has a 3/4 height glass wall on one entire side facing Denver’s vibrant downtown that make it sunny and bright. It’s full deck looks out on the Millennium Bridge for some of the best people watching in Denver while enjoying your morning coffee or evening beverages. Two bicycles are included for exploring the seemingly endless Platte River and Cherry Creek paved trails, and the rest of downtown. High-end furnishings and modern art compliment the high ceilings and modern feel of it’s luxury interior. In the three bedrooms there are two king beds and one queen. The sofa in the living room has a pull-out mattress. Full cable packages exist in the living room (with DVR), and both King bedrooms. There is a Bose bluetooth sound bar in the living room. Location of Denver attractions and walking time: Sports Authority Field- 1.6 Miles/ 33 minutes* Elitch's- 0.7 Miles/ 14 minutes Coors Field- 0.8 Miles/ 18 minutes Pepsi Center- 0.5 Miles/ 11 minutes Downtown Aquarium- 0.6 Miles/ 14 minutes* Children's Museum- 0.9 Mile/ 19 minutes* Buelle Theatre- 1.1 Miles/ 23 minutes REI- 0.3 Miles/ 7 minutes Union Station- 0.25 Miles/ 6 Minutes Colorado Convention Center- 1.3 Miles/ 28 Minutes Denver Trolley- 0.3 Miles/ 8 minutes* *Denver trolley stops at Downtown Aquarium, Children's Museum, and Sports Authority Field and operates from Memorial Day to Labor Day, and for all Broncos home games. ****ALL STAYS OVER 30 DAYS WILL REQUIRE A MID STAY CLEAN (priced at 1/2 the original cleaning fee).
